Headset Operation

Your i 5803 Handset is equipped with a 2.5mm Headset Jack for use with an optional accessory Headset for handsfree operation. If you choose to use the Headset option, you must obtain an optional accessory Headset that is compatible with the i 5803. For best results, use a VTech 2.5mm headset.

Once you have a compatible 2.5mm Headset, locate the Headset Jack on the i 5803 Handset. Connect the plug on the Headset cord to the jack (under a small rubber flag) on the cordless Handset. The plug should fit securely. Do not force the connection.

NOTE:

Whenever a compatible Headset is connected to the cordless Handset, the microphone on the Handset will be muted. This is done to limit the effect of background noise.

Many compatible Headsets have a reversible, monaural design. This means you can wear your Headset on either ear, leaving one ear free for other conversations.

Belt Clip

The i 5803 is also equipped with a detachable belt clip. Align the pins on the inside edge of the clip with the notches on the sides of the Handset. The belt clip should snap securely into place. Do not force the connection.
